WebMay 14, 2024 · Cloning can be done in vitro, by a process called the polymerase chain reaction (PCR). Here, however, we shall examine how cloning is done in vivo. Cloning in vivo can be done in unicellular microbes like E. coli unicellular eukaryotes like yeast and in mammalian cells grown in tissue culture. WebSep 9, 2024 · A cloning vector is used to carry the recombinant DNA into living cells, so that the cells can synthesize the encoded proteins. The best cloning vectors are small in size, able to replicate its DNA, contain restriction enzyme recognition sites, and have a marker gene (usually antibiotic resistance gene).
